--- Quote from: Ralph Hardwick on April 20, 2010, 09:08:12 ---I have posted this on other forums and had agreat deal of interest so I thought I would add it here.
After an abortive trip to Morocco last year, we are preparing for a trip to the Tunisian Sahara in October 2010.
My car was fairly well prepared but we are making many more mods to turn it into a full blown overland/expedition vehicle over the next few months.
I have detailed some of these and I will be adding plenty more on my website (address in signature below). You are welcome to comment and ask any questions.
I shall make the articles as detailed as possible to show how things were fitted, where they came from, how they were made and how successful they were.
In addition I will be running a 'countdown blog' until we leave on the 2nd October 2010 and then updating it remotely during the trip.
Many of the ideas and mods have come from things I have seen on forums and other personal websites. This site is my way of giving something back to the online community.
